90 changes: 90 additions & 0 deletions docs/conf.py
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,90 @@
# Configuration file for the Sphinx documentation builder.
#
# This file only contains a selection of the most common options. For a full
# list see the documentation:
# https://www.sphinx-doc.org/en/master/usage/configuration.html

# -- Path setup --------------------------------------------------------------

# If extensions (or modules to document with autodoc) are in another directory,
# add these directories to sys.path here. If the directory is relative to the
# documentation root, use os.path.abspath to make it absolute, like shown here.
#
# import os
# import sys
# sys.path.insert(0, os.path.abspath('.'))

import os
import sys

sys.path.insert(0, os.path.abspath(".."))

import symengine

# -- Project information -----------------------------------------------------

project = 'symengine'
copyright = '2021, SymEngine development team <symengine@googlegroups.com>'
author = 'SymEngine development team <symengine@googlegroups.com>'

# The full version, including alpha/beta/rc tags
release = '0.6.1'


# -- General configuration ---------------------------------------------------

# Add any Sphinx extension module names here, as strings. They can be
# extensions coming with Sphinx (named 'sphinx.ext.*') or your custom
# ones.
extensions = [
"sphinx.ext.autodoc", # Consumes docstrings
"sphinx.ext.napoleon", # Allows for Google Style Docs
"sphinx.ext.viewcode", # Links to source code
"sphinx.ext.intersphinx", # Connects to other documentation
"sphinx.ext.todo", # Show TODO details
"sphinx.ext.imgconverter", # Handle svg images
"sphinx.ext.duration", # Shows times in the processing pipeline
"sphinx.ext.mathjax", # Need math support
"sphinx.ext.githubpages", # Puts the .nojekyll and CNAME files
"sphinxcontrib.apidoc", # Automatically sets up sphinx-apidoc
# "recommonmark", # Parses markdown
"m2r2", # Parses markdown in rst
]

# Add any paths that contain templates here, relative to this directory.
templates_path = ['_templates']

# List of patterns, relative to source directory, that match files and
# directories to ignore when looking for source files.
# This pattern also affects html_static_path and html_extra_path.
exclude_patterns = ['_build', 'Thumbs.db', '.DS_Store']

# API Doc settings
apidoc_module_dir = "../"
apidoc_output_dir = "source"
apidoc_excluded_paths = ["tests"]
apidoc_separate_modules = True

# -- Options for HTML output -------------------------------------------------

# The theme to use for HTML and HTML Help pages. See the documentation for
# a list of builtin themes.
#
html_theme = "sphinx_book_theme"
html_title = "Symengine Python Bindings"
# html_logo = "path/to/logo.png"
# html_favicon = "path/to/favicon.ico"
html_theme_options = {
"repository_url": "https://github.com/symengine/symengine.py",
"use_repository_button": True,
"use_issues_button": True,
"use_edit_page_button": True,
"path_to_docs": "docs",
"use_download_button": True,
"home_page_in_toc": True
}

# Add any paths that contain custom static files (such as style sheets) here,
# relative to this directory. They are copied after the builtin static files,
# so a file named "default.css" will overwrite the builtin "default.css".
html_static_path = ['_static']

39 changes: 39 additions & 0 deletions nix/nsymengine.nix
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,39 @@
{ stdenv
, fetchFromGitHub
, cmake
, gmp
, flint
, mpfr
, libmpc
}:

stdenv.mkDerivation rec {
pname = "symengine";
name = "symengine";
version = "44eb47e3bbfa7e06718f2f65f3f41a0a9d133b70"; # From symengine-version.txt

src = fetchFromGitHub {
owner = "symengine";
repo = "symengine";
rev = "${version}";
sha256 = "137cxk3x8vmr4p5x0knzjplir0slw0gmwhzi277si944i33781hd";
};

nativeBuildInputs = [ cmake ];

buildInputs = [ gmp flint mpfr libmpc ];

cmakeFlags = [
"-DWITH_FLINT=ON"
"-DINTEGER_CLASS=flint"
"-DWITH_SYMENGINE_THREAD_SAFE=yes"
"-DWITH_MPC=yes"
"-DBUILD_TESTS=no"
"-DBUILD_FOR_DISTRIBUTION=yes"
];

doCheck = false;

}

# Derived from the upstream expression : https://github.com/r-ryantm/nixpkgs/blob/34730e0640710636b15338f20836165f29b3df86/pkgs/development/libraries/symengine/default.nix
